1. Caution
* This appliance is intended for use in household and similar applications.
* This appliance is not intended for use by persons (including children) with reduced physical, sensory or
mental capabilities, or lack of experience and knowledge, unless they have been given supervision or
instruction concerning use of the appliance by a person responsible for their safety.
* Please unplug the power cord when cleaning the machine or if it remains without being used for a long
time. If the supply cord is damaged, it must be replaced by the manufacturer, its service agent or similarly
qualified persons in order to avoid any hazards.
* Do not dispose of electrical appliances as unsorted municipal waste, use separate collection facilities.
Contact your local government for information regarding the available collection systems. If electrical
appliances are disposed of in landfills or dumps, hazardous substances can leak into the groundwater.
* Please do not immerse the housing into water or clean it with a lot of water to avoid the danger of electric
shock or machine damage. Use a moist cloth to scrub and avoid the flow in of water.
* Stir blade is SHARP! Be careful when dismantling or reassembling.
* Food capacity should not exceed 2L.
* Please do not turn on the cover until the machine stops stirring, especially when the speed is above 5.
* When heating or taking out the SS jar after heating, do not touch the SS body to avoid scalding.
* When opening the SS jar cover or steamer cover, be cautious in order to avoid the vapor scalding.
Do not touch the cover when heating.
* Children should be supervised to ensure that they do not play with the appliance. Make sure to place
the machine out of the reach of children. Warn children that the machine could become hot and shouldn’t
be touched.

* Please press the measuring cup down when the speed is above 5 or crushing frozen food in the Turbo
function.
* This machine may move under operation. Please place the machine on a steady table and ensure it
remains in a safe distance from table edges to avoid falling.
* Please make sure to keep enough space above the unit when it is in use.
* The machine will stop if overloaded. Be cautious as the red LED will be powered on, with an audio beep
if overloaded (Figure 1). The orange LED will be powered on, with an audio beep if the unit is overheated
(Figure 2).
Figure 1 Figure 2
* Before using, turn the power switch to the “I” position. After use, please turn the power switch to
the “O” position.
2. Technical data
Machine Max. Power: 1400W
Motor power: 600W
Heating Wattage: 1300W
Stir blade unloading: RPM 200 – 10,000.
Material of SS jar: SS 304. Max working capacity is 2L
Voltage: 220 – 240V~
Length of Power cord: 1.3M

Removal of the Stainless Steel jar
Press the “Start/Stop” button to stop the machine, then turn the switch on top anti-clockwise and press the
cover release button (Figure 9) until the latch unlocks. The jar cover shouldn’t be left standing upright
(Figure10); instead you need to take it off after you're finished (Figure 11). Finally, hold the handle of
the SS jar and turn the jar slowly clockwise from the (Figure 4) position to the (Figure 3) position. The SS
jar can then be taken off from housing.
Figure 9 Figure 10 Figure 11
LCD display
Plug in the machine and switch on the electrical button in the housing. If the SS jar is not placed correctly
or the top switch is not switched correctly, the LCD will display as (Figure 12). When the SS jar is placed
correctly, and top switch is switched correctly, the LCD would display as (Figure 13).
Time, temperature and speed can be adjusted under this condition.
Note: For safety considerations, when cover is closed correctly, the top switch cannot be
switched to the right place. Please do not switch it by force.

How to dismantle the blade assembly
Figure 14 is blade assembly. While reaching with one hand into the SS jar to hold the semi-circle section
on blade assembly (Figure 15), use the other hand to turn off the nut in an anti-clockwise direction
(Figure 16), then pull out the blade assembly.
Figure 15 Figure 16
! Caution: The stirring blade is extremely sharp. To avoid injury, please do not touch the edge directly
when dismantling. User should hold the upper part when removing or replacing the blade assembly to
avoid the blade assembly falling off, possibly leading to an accident.
How to assemble the blade assembly
Reverse the process of dismantle blade assembly.
Usage and how to use the accessories
1. SS jar cover: To cover the jar, the sealed ring inside can prevent food, soup or vapor spillage; When
assembled, the seal ring “ESTA CARA A LA TAPA↑, FACE UP ↑” warning words should face towards you
(see below Figure 17). Otherwise, the liquid may spill (Figure 18).
Figure 17 Figure 18
2. Measure cup: To cover the jar cover and also to measure liquid food.
3. Basket: Multi-function accessory. Can filter fruit juice and vegetable juice, also can cook vegetables
Page 9
such as potatoes, tomatoes, onions... etc.
It is very easy to remove the basket. Use the spatula to hook the middle part of the basket handle as
shown in (Figure 19).
Spatula
Basket handle
Figure 19 Figure 20
4. Spatula: Use to scrape ingredients from the SS jar’s inner wall. When filtering juice, it can also be used
to fix the basket, and at the same time to ensure separating the juice from the solid ingredients. (Figure
20)
5. Butterfly (must use with Blade guard together): Continuous blending can ensure optimum
mixing, and prevent sticking when heating milk, making butter pudding or fruit sauces.
To assemble and dismantle the butterfly, see Figure21. To assemble the butterfly, see Figure
22. Using the two half-circle of the blade guard as a guide, insert the butterfly covering the blade guard,
and then rotate down clockwise. To dismantle it, hold the SS jar handle with one hand while the other hand
holds the blade guard top to pull it off in force.
(Attention: When using the butterfly, the speed has to be set to a maximum of 4.
6. Blade guard: Blend & mix soft or liquid foods. Method with using or assembling the blade guard: Before
assembling, the user should take off the blade assembly from the SS jar, and then put the blade guard
covering in the top surface of the blade. While twisting slightly down, assemble them together in the SS
jar and screw down the bottom nut (the blade guard is used under speed 4).

7. Steaming pot: Includes the steaming pot, the steaming disc, and the steaming cover. Could be used
to steam large quantity food with similar tastes, such as vegetables, potatoes, thickly sliced meats,
sausages and fish... etc.
8. Caution: please pay attention to avoid being scalded by vapor.
How to use the steaming pot in the correct way
Step 1: Put at least 500g water in the SS jar (Figure23).
Step 2: Please assemble the SS jar into position on the unit (Figure 24), and then put food (such as ice
and potato) in filter. Put cover on and ensure the bottom is fastened well and twisted into the right place.
Figure 23 Figure 24
Figure 25
When putting food in the steaming pot, place the easily cooked food on the bottom, and the not so easily
cooked food on top. If necessary, the steaming disc could be used to put food on.
Step 3: Cover the steaming pot (Figure 25) so that steaming air won’t be released.
Page 11
Important reminder:
●When the steaming pot is in use, please keep children well away from machine and notify them of
the dangers of the steam.
Operation: Set up the time and steaming temperature on the control panel and press the “Start/Stop”
button. The cooking will start accordingly. Steam vapors go to steaming pot through holes in the stainless
steel jar cover, and the food will be cooked.
When opening the steam cover, please be careful to put it slightly angled, so that the hot steam vapors
spill out rearward, and cooled water can flow into the steaming pot. Take off the cover and put it on the
table, then take up the steaming pot and hold it for several seconds. Let cooled water drip into the stainless
steel jar cover, and put the steaming pot in the steaming cover.

7. If you would like to heat or cook food, please follow the following steps
Step 1: Set time
Set up the time by “Time” button; max is 90min.
Press the “Time” button and the “Time ▶” characters will be highlighted; press the “+” button to add more
time and the “-”button to remove time. Holding down “+” or “-” button will add or reduce time quickly. Set up time: Press once “+” or “-” to change times in periods of 1 minute. Double press quickly to indicate
seconds.
Step 2: Set temperature
Before cooking, please choose temperature first. If you don’t need heat, please go to step 3.
Set up temperature: Press the “Temp” button and the indicator will be highlighted; then press “+” to raise the temperature. Press the “-”button to reduce temperature. Hold “+” or “-” button down to raise or lower
temperature quickly.
Note: Every press on “+” or “- will add or reduce 10 degrees Celsius.
Temperature adjusting scope: Heating temperature can be selected from 30 to 120 degrees Celsius.
Step 3: Blade assembly stirring speed set up
Stirring speed set up: Press the “Speed” button and the indicator will be highlighted. Press the “+” button
to add speed and press “-” to reduce it. Hold “+” or “-” down to change the speed settings quickly. Note:
When blending, adjust speed to 1-5. When making a sauce, adjust speed to 5-9.
Step 4: Press “Start/Stop” button
After pressing “Start/Stop” button, you will hear the operation tone and the machine will start working. After
the machine has started, the set-up time will count down to “00:00” and the machine will beep when the
process is finished. In operation status, press “Start/Stop” again, and the machine will stop.
Important notes:
1. If you do not select the heating function or time, but only set up stirring speed, the machine will start
and will run under auto time. The max working time is 20 minutes. When the unit has been working for 20
minutes the machine will stop automatically and make a beep sound.
2.When selecting the heating function, it’s necessary to set up time and speed and then start heating or
cooking. If you set up the heating temperature but do not set a time, the machine will not start up. When
heating is finished (i.e. the time countdown reaches “00:00”), the machine will stop heating but the blade
inside the stainless steel jar will continue to stir for 10 min in order to avoid burning the food or sticking to
the jar. Once the timer is finished, the stirring will stop and the unit will beep.
3. When choosing the heating function, speed can be set up in maximum speed 5.
4. When the time countdown reaches “00:00”, the machine will beep. The machine will beep again
after 5 minutes if no action has been performed in this time.
Page 13
8. Dough pattern
Use this pattern to make yeast dough or bread dough (LCD display as figure 27)
Operation: Set up time first, then press the “Dough” button. Finally, press the “Start/Stop” button. This
pattern will make the machine operate in the pre-set program, working in 3 speed for 3 second, then stop
for 4 seconds and then repeat.
Figure 27
Example: Put 500g flour into the stainless steel jar (it should be thoroughly dry), and place it into position.
Set up the time to 3 minutes, press “Dough” button, and then press the “Start/Stop” button. The machine
will work under its pre-set program. Following the procedure, put 300g water slowly into the stainless steel
jar (all the amount should be poured in within one minute). Dough will be done within 3 minutes.
Note: When you use dough pattern, the stainless steel jar should be dry before you put the flour to prevent
it from sticking to the jar during the blending process. The flour mustn’t exceed 500g, the water shouldn’t
exceed 300g, and the set-up time shouldn’t exceed 3 minutes. The proportion between flour and water is
5:3 and the results may be improved if you add some extracted oil into the flour.
Caution: Remove the blade after dough completion; please be cautious to avoid injuries to your hand by
the sharp blade.
This machine may move when making dough, so please place it on a steady heat-resistant table, in a safe
distance from the edges to avoid falling.
Please do not use the machine without the guards in place, and ensure they don't fall off during the
operation.
9. Turbo (Pulse) button
No need to set up time and stirring speed, just press the “Turbo (Pulse)” button continuously, and the
machine would operate in max speed. The machine will stop when the button is released. This button is
used to crash hard food such as ice cubes.
Note: “Turbo” mode will not function under dough pattern.
Caution: If you use Turbo (Pulse) for heated food, the weight of food should not exceed 1000g. The
measuring cup should be positioned on the stainless steel jar’s cover to avoid scalding by food spillage.

10. Cleaning
Before the first use, the unit should be thoroughly cleaned, including all food-contactable accessories. To
clean the stainless steel jar and cover, disassemble the blade assembly and the sealing ring first (please
take reference of prior instructions)
Use hot water to clean the stainless steel jar and housing (excluding blade). You can also clean the
spatula, butterfly, blade guard, filter, measuring cup, cover and steamer at the same time.
Note: In the event of a sticky or un-easily cleaned matter stuck to the stainless steel jar or stainless
steel accessory, please make use of a suitable stainless steel detergent.
How to clean the blade assembly
Hold the blade assembly’s bottom and place it under the tap to flush. A scrubbing brush could also be
used. Notice: Please pay attention when dismantling the blade assembly to avoid injuring your hand.
How to clean steamer
Please use dishwasher to the clean steamer and the cover. A soft cloth and detergent can also be used.
How to clean the housing
Use a soft cloth or detergent to clean. Please do not use water directly to avoid water going into
internal housing areas.
Notice: Unplug unit prior to cleaning.

11. Using recipes
When preparing the food from your recipe, please consider the order of every process.
Caution: Please ensure the stainless steel jar capacity does not exceed 2 liters.
Set-up order
You will get the best results by following this suggested order:
If you want to cook food, please set time, temperature, speed, and press “Start/Stop” button. If you
want to blend or chop food; please set time, speed, and press “Start/Stop” button.
Example: Cooking Food
a. Set time to 45 minute
b. Choose temperature to 120°
c. Set speed to 3
d. Press the “Start/Stop” button.
Example: Chopping Vegetables
a. Set time to 30 seconds
b. Set speed to 6
c. Press the “Start/Stop” button.
Example: Crushing Ice Cubes
Do not exceed 300g ice cube in SS jar.
a. Set time to 1 minute
b. Set speed to 9
c. Press the “Start/Stop” button
Example: Blending Carrot Juice
Do not exceed 400g carrot in stainless jar and 600g water
a. Set time to 1 minute
b. Set speed to 9
c. Press the “Start/Stop” button
Example: Grinding Coffee
Do not put more than 200 grams of coffee beans into jar
a. Set the time to 2 minute
b. Set speed to 9
c. Press the “Start/Stop” button
